Linda Gail Van Santen (nee Jay)
March 27, 1947 – February 13, 2023
Passed away peacefully with her family by her side at home on February 13,2023. Linda, in her 76th year, beloved wife and best friend of Johannes (Kees) for 54 years. Loving mother of Leah (Kerry) and Aaron, all of Kemptville. Special Grandma to Ryan, Owen and Kassidy. Dear daughter of the late Thelma and Jack Jay. Dear sister of Sandy (Allen) McIntosh of Brockville and Sister-in-law to Rudie (Patricia), Marian (Claude) of Brockville and Robert (Sandy) of Kingston. Also survived by numerous nieces and nephews. Born in Almont, On, moved to Kemptville in 1953 and raised by her Grandfather Daniel Jay. Attended school at North Grenville District High School then nursing school at Brockville General where she earned her RN license. Worked at the old Bayfield Manor, VON and retired from the Kemptville District Hospital in 2012.
A private family service was held February 16th with a family burial planned for the spring. Special thanks to Georgie and Melanie from Bayshore Home Care. In lieu of flowers, donations to the Canadian Cancer Society would be gratefully accepted.
